Not sure if anyone else has developed a clicking issue on the seat bottom of their drivers seat, but I did. I noticed the clicking after I had a ton of warranty work done, so I’m assuming some large Marge sat in my car.

Anyways, I pulled the seat out and took it apart. I isolated the clicking to the actual metal cage skeleton. After pushing and pulling on the metal, I found a tack weld had partially come loose. I circled the plug weld in red that had partially popped in the picture below.

This was not weld failure, rather it was not enough weld applied. I should mention I’m out of warranty, which is why I just fixed this myself. Once I found the problem area, I brought the seat out to my garage and welded it with the same er70s6 wire used when it was manufactured.

I have an early build ‘17. Not sure who/if anyone else has this issue. I’m 6’5” 215lbs, and gingerly get in and out of the car, but I’m sure I put different pressures on the seat bottom than a shorter stockier person.

Mine has that clicking as well, it's more noticeable on right corners. I'm the second owner of the car so I can't say what caused it in the first place.
The seat is very easy to remove and take apart. Almost too easy. I’d be willing to bet you have the same problem. I noticed the clicking on hard right turns and weaving back and forth. Duplicated the sound by pushing hard on the spot and traced it down.
